What is the Residential Transition Tracking Form?
The Residential Transition Tracking Form is a critical tool used in the healthcare and social services sectors to document the transition of individuals between various placements. This form captures comprehensive individual details, including the consumer’s name, clinical provider information, and guardian contacts, ensuring that all pertinent data is tracked accurately. By effectively utilizing a healthcare transition form, professionals ensure seamless transitions for individuals needing support.

Key Features of the Residential Transition Tracking Form
This form includes several essential features designed to streamline the documentation process:
-
Sections for detailed consumer information and clinical histories
-
Placement status indicators to track each individual's location
-
Involvement of applicable agencies to foster collaborative coordination
-
Flexible format with blank fields and checkboxes for diverse input examples
The emphasis on customizable input ensures that the form meets the specific needs of various users while maintaining the integrity of collected data.

How to fill out the Transition Tracking Form
-
1.To access the Residential Transition Tracking Form on pdfFiller, navigate to their website and use the search bar to enter the form name.
-
2.Once you locate the form, click on it to open it in the pdfFiller editor interface.
-
3.Before completing the form, gather necessary information including the consumer's name, current placement details, guardian information, and involvement from agencies like DSS or DJJDP.
-
4.Use the pdfFiller tools to fill in each blank field according to the information you collected. You can click in each field to type or select options from checkboxes.
-
5.Ensure you input detailed notes in the sections requesting additional information about the individual’s history, school enrollment, and treatment plans.
-
6.After populating all fields, review the filled form for accuracy to prevent any potential errors or omissions.
-
7.Once you are satisfied with the information provided, you can either save the document directly to your pdfFiller account or download it to your device in the preferred format.
-
8.Finally, if necessary, submit the completed form via the appropriate channels specified for your organization or retain it for record-keeping purposes.
